While serving as the head of the Virginia Tobacco Region Revitalization Commission, Evan Feinman couldn’t figure out why typical economic development strategies weren’t working.

Feinman was tasked with revitalizing communities that suffered after the disappearance of the tobacco industry, breathing new life into towns that historically relied on the crop for their economic welfare. He came across places with traditionally great attributes like easy access to transportation and a strong talent pool, but businesses still weren’t coming in the way he expected.

Talking on the ground with industry stakeholders and decision-makers, Feinman realized what the problem was. While the communities had plenty to offer, it made no sense for new businesses to come to towns lacking high-speed internet.

“They says, ‘There’s no broadband. We have fiber right at the industrial site, but there’s no broadband in town,’” Feinman says. “They says, ‘I can’t tell my boss to put a $350 million factory here if he can’t email the plant manager at 2 a.m.’”

That was when Feinman knew Virginia needed to expand broadband statewide. The tobacco commission wound up laying 3,000 miles of fiber, and Feinman continued to push for universal broadband, getting Democratic gubernatorial candidate to take it seriously.

After Northam’s election, he asked Feinman if he would run a statewide universal broadband program. The Virginia Initiative (VATI) started in 2017 under the to fund public-private partnerships with a goal of expanding internet access everywhere in the state by the early 2020s.

Since then, the goalposts moved a bit, Feinman says, but Virginia remains on track to be the first state of its size to achieve universal broadband coverage.

It’s been almost a decade since Virginia started the push to bring broadband to every citizen in the commonwealth. And now, roughly 10 years later, the commonwealth is close to connecting the entire state to high-speed internet.

When Virginia’s broadband expansion started in 2017, the state estimated that 500,000 homes, businesses and community anchors lacked broadband access at that time, says Chandler Vaughan, acting director of the office of broadband under the Department of Housing and Community Development. Today, Vaughan says, nearly all those projects are funded, but 209,518 remain to be built out.

Getting this far has not been easy. There’s rural terrain to cover, there are debates over what technologies are best for which situations, and there’s money to be disbursed. All in all, Virginia has invested $1.5 billion toward expanding broadband. The first investment, in 2017, was $1 million.

‘Basic infrastructure’

Economic growth in 2026 requires broadband, says Feinman, who went on to create the federal Broadband Equity, Access, and Deployment Program (BEAD) in the , nationalizing what he created in Virginia.

“The simple fact is it’s a basic quality-of-life requirement, and its absence can really prevent economic growth,” says Feinman, who now is vice president of strategy at JSI, a telecommunications solutions firm that helps rural and independent broadband/telecom providers build, operate and scale fiber and digital networks. Quality internet access, he points out, has implications for everything from remote healthcare to learning opportunities for young people.

“It’s become the next layer of basic infrastructure, like things out there like roads, bridges, and electricity,” Vaughan says.

On a practical level, the work to expand broadband is a communal effort between state government, local jurisdictions and the electric utilities and telecommunications companies that install the infrastructure. VATI provides grants to local governments, which then partner with internet service providers to extend broadband connectivity. The grants are matched by private and local funds.

A major hurdle was crossed late last year, when Virginia’s final BEAD proposal to expand broadband received approval from the U.S. Department of Commerce program. The approval gave the commonwealth the go-ahead to distribute $545 million in federal funds to 23 internet service providers that could then leverage almost $430 million in private dollars toward reaching universal broadband access in Virginia.

Before the BEAD proposal was approved, broadband expansion efforts in Virginia were funded by $731 million in federal COVID-19 funds and $195 million from the state’s general fund.

There’s also another $800 million-plus that comes with the BEAD approval, Vaughan says, but the state can’t use it yet because the federal government hasn’t issued guidance.

Getting the government involved in broadband expansion was essential, Feinman says, because the economics of expanding to rural communities aren’t favorable for the private sector.

“You’ve got a fundamental math problem: A mile of fiber optic cable costs the same amount to run in Arlington that it does in Alleghany, but in Arlington, there are thousands of potential customers and in Alleghany, it might get you three,” he explains. “The return on capital in areas where the population density falls low enough isn’t there to make sense. In some instances, it’s literally negative.”

Shenandoah Telecommunications, better known as Shentel, knows this well. The 124-year-old company got its start as a farmers’ mutual telephone cooperative in Shenandoah County and puts an emphasis on expanding broadband into rural areas, Brian Byrd, government and community affairs specialist for Shentel, says.

Filling in cracks

Before VATI, expanding broadband took a bits-and-pieces approach, where there would be a grant here and a loan there, but not much in the way of coordinated efforts, Byrd says.

“We understood how difficult it was to get to these people. We knew a subsidy had to be part of the picture for rural Virginia,” says Chris Kyle, Shentel’s vice president of regulatory and industry affairs.

Having preexisting relationships in the community helped, so when VATI funding came through, Shentel knew how to use it, Kyle says. The company was awarded money to provide broadband to 18,000 locations, or “passings,” and the work is close to being done, Byrd says.

In May, Shentel announced it completed a $20 million VATI project in Campbell County, bringing service to 4,100 previously unserved homes. It also completed a $32 million project to 6,700 Franklin County homes that same month.

“We were careful about our partnerships, and the size of projects. We took a conservative, judicious approach,” he says.

Close to 100% of the 500,000 estimated connections needed to reach homes, businesses, and community anchors lacking broadband access in 2017 have been funded, Vaughan says.

BEAD allowed the commonwealth to fund broadband for 85,069 locations, he says. VATI funded 372,298, which leaves a balance of 42,633 funded by other federal programs that don’t go through the broadband office, Vaughan says.

On the construction side, VATI has allowed for build-out to 243,058 locations as of April 30, Vaughan says. BEAD and VATI-funded projects still need to connect to 209,518 locations; the remaining 47,454 have been built out by a different federal program, he says.

Construction on BEAD-funded projects is expected to start later this year, Vaughan says, pending permitting approval.

Vaughan estimates construction on the BEAD-funded projects to be finished “at the end of the decade, in 2030.” But the last-mile portion of broadband expansion might be the hardest, he says.

“The majority of what’s funded under BEAD are those that haven’t been included in previous projects, ones that fell through the cracks,” he says. “The vast majority of these are far-reaching in even rural counties, where we’re burying fiber within rock, replacing poles and rock, or running fiber a mile or two over the road before you get to the first house. The price tag reflects that too.”

Fiber vs. satellite

When it comes to what technology is used to expand broadband, Vaughan says, Virginia is a “technology-neutral state in the broadband expansion world.

“We defer to local governments that bring us applications to select their preferred provider and preferred technology,” he says. “Under the BEAD program, we received applications from private companies for the first time, talking about the feasibility of tech working and cost-effectiveness.”

Most awards have been for fiber, Vaughan says, because of its scalability.

“You’ve seen over the last 10 years, demand at household level of connectivity and data usage is skyrocketing, and you’re only going to see that more,” he says. “Those network demands are best served by technology that can meet that over time, and that’s fiber. The only limits to the speed cap of fiber are the things at the end of the network.”

Even though fiber is versatile, Vaughan says, other technologies like satellite internet access are in the portfolio as well. Satellite services Starlink (by SpaceX) and Amazon Leo have been awarded BEAD funds for Virginia projects — between the two of them, they’ll cover 11,000 locations, Vaughan says.

Satellite makes sense in very remote locations where it’s not worth it to build out fiber capacity. The BEAD process covers $10,500 per location for fiber; anything above that goes to satellite, he says.

“That’s measured on an average cost per home basis,” he clarifies. “On an average, if there’s 500 homes in a project area and a $5 million subsidy, that’s $10,000 per home, that project was allowed to move forward.”

While the commonwealth is still waiting for guidance on its $800 million in remaining BEAD funding, Vaughan says it could be used for precision agriculture, artificial intelligence literacy and workforce development.

The broadband office is also paying close attention to expanding cellular service, he says. There are too many places in Virginia where it’s hard to even make a call on a cellphone.

“What good is having fiber when you can’t step out your front door and call 911?” he asks.
